Hard to find in any condition and certainly never in multiples – we are delighted to have one of the rarest South African Dinky models for sale! Unfinished models were exported to South Africa from 1966. They were sent as castings and painted and assembled there largely as a way of getting around the laws prohibiting export of finished goods to South Africa at this time. All housed in Dinky boxes with some Afrikaans text and of course most importantly the Arthur E.Harris print on the box.
South African versions of French Dinky are even harder to find and this French Dinky Chevrolet Corvair is in virtually mint condition in a complete, clean and bright Afrikaans box! Few tiny flecks of surface loss. Very light wear besides.
Silver-grey finish and a fine silver trim, ivory detailed interior and shiny spun wheels. Smooth white original tyres (one is a touch mis-shapen now). Shiny base has ‘Dinky Toys Chevrolet Corvair Made in France Meccano’.
